WebSep 30, 2024 · The lower the DPI, the less sensitive the mouse is. This means that if you’re working with a higher DPI mouse, even moving your mouse even a little bit will move the cursor a large distance across your screen. The average mouse these days have a DPI of 1600, and gaming mice tend to have 4000 DPI or more.
